Blair to visit Israel next week, says optimistic about progress
By News Agencies

Former British prime minister Tony Blair will visit Israel next week on his first trip tot he region in his new capacity as Quartet envoy to the Middle East.

Blair said Thursday he was optimistic momentum could be regained in talks between Israel and the Palestinians.

Speaking at a press conference following the Quartet meeting in Lisbon, Blair said there is no more important issue for peace and security in the world, and that he felt duty-bound to do what he could.

He brushed aside suggestions that his limited mandate as special envoy to the Quartet, and the group's refusal to deal with the hardline Palestinian movement Hamas, would hamstring his mission, which begins in earnest when he makes his first trip to the region expected in the coming days.

"I'm nothing if not an optimist," Blair said following a meeting that brought together senior representatives from the United States, the European Union, the United Nations and Russia, which together comprise the Quartet.

"I will probably have need for all that quality of optimism in this task ahead, but I am determined to try," he continued.

Blair gave no specifics on when he would make his first visit to the region, saying only that it would be soon, and that he would return later for a longer trip. President Shimon Peres has said he would be meeting with Blair in Israel on Tuesday.

Before the meeting, the United States and European Union held firm Thursday to their refusal to deal with the militant Palestinian Hamas movement.

Secretary of State Condoleezza Rice and Portuguese Foreign Minister Luis Amado, whose country holds the rotating EU presidency, both rejected any dealings with Hamas, even as some questioned if the stance could compromise Blair's work with the Palestinians.

"Hamas, I think, knows what is expected for international respectability," Rice told reporters at a news conference in Lisbon with Amado shortly before the international diplomatic Quartet was to hold its first high-level meeting with Blair.

She said neither the Quartet nor Washington would deal with Hamas unless it recognizes Israel's right to exist and renounces terrorism, ruling out its participation in an upcoming Middle East peace meeting called by President Bush.

"I see no conditions at the moment to engage (in) new relations with Hamas without a new position from them," Amado said.

In addition to Blair making his first appearance before the Quartet principals, Thursday's meeting will also be the first at its most senior level since Hamas wrested control of the Gaza Strip, ousting Palestinian Authority Chairman Mahmoud Abbas' Fatah faction-led government, which the Quartet and Israel recognize as legitimate.

The power grab split the Palestinian leadership and placed yet another obstacle in the way of a Mideast peace deal. But it also prompted Israel and the West to seek ways to shore up the beleaguered Abbas.

Rice said she sensed a kind of momentum building in Middle East peace efforts, including Blair's appointment as Quartet envoy and Bush's call for a meeting this fall between Israel, the Palestinians and neighboring Arab states.

On her way to Lisbon, Rice hailed Blair as a historic and passionate leader, saying his debut as envoy could breath new life into long-stalled talks between Israel and the Palestinians.

At the same time, she defended the decision to limit Blair's mandate to helping Palestinians develop their infrastructure and economy, saying his role would complement U.S.-led diplomatic efforts - and that there was plenty of work for everyone.

"This is a very skilled, respected, historic figure in many ways in the world, who is absolutely dedicated to democracy, to building a better Middle East," Rice told reporters aboard her plane.

While Blair brings gravitas and enthusiasm to the role, critics say his limited mandate to help the Palestinians develop institutions and rule of law along with orders not to deal with Hamas will make it difficult for him to achieve a breakthrough.

Rice, who as America's senior diplomat is charged with the role as chief peacemaker, defended the division of responsibilities.

"There is also a political track that for a variety of reasons, the United States is committed to lead in coordination with the Quartet," she said.

"Blair's role is something that is completely complimentary and if we all work together, and there is plenty to do, perhaps we can finally deliver," Rice said.

The Quartet should also endorse U.S. plans to revive Israeli-Palestinian peace moves when they meet on Thursday, Rice said.

"The Quartet members have already made clear that they endorse what the president has said," she said.

Egyptian foreign minister says Mideast conference to be held in New York in September
Egypt's Foreign Minister Ahmed Aboul Gheit said Thursday that the Mideast peace conference called for by Bush will be held in September on the sidelines of the UN General Assembly meeting in New York.

Aboul Gheit said that ahead of the conference, Rice will discuss its agenda with Arab foreign ministers on July 31 in the Egyptian Red Sea resort town of Sharm el-Sheik.

"Egypt's vision is that the meeting should handle a wide number of issues, including launching the peace process in active negotiations between the Israeli and Palestinian parties," Aboul Gheit told reporters at a press conference in Cairo.

However, Suleiman Awad, the Egyptian presidential spokesman, later told The Associated Press that it is not yet clear when or where the Mideast conference will be held.
